Fusion reaction of a weakly-bound nucleus with a deformed target
Abstract
We discuss the role of deformation of the target nucleus in the fusion reaction of the 15C + 232Th system at energies around the Coulomb barrier, for which 15C is a well-known one-neutron halo nucleus. To this end, we construct the potential between 15C and 232Th with the double folding procedure, assuming that the projectile nucleus is composed of the core nucleus, 14C, and a valance neutron. By taking into account the halo nature of the projectile nucleus as well as the deformation of the target nucleus, we simultaneously reproduce the fusion cross sections for the 14C + 232Th and the 15C + 232Th systems. Our calculation indicates that the net effect of the breakup and the transfer channels is small for this system.
